1. 引言
Linux和Windows是两个广泛使用的操作系统,它们在时间管理功能上有着一些不同之处。时间管理对于计算机用户来说非常重要,它涵盖了时钟同步、日期和时间设置以及时间跟踪等方面。本文将会比较Linux和Windows操作系统的时间管理功能,并详细介绍它们各自的特点和优势。
2. 时钟同步
时钟同步是操作系统中非常重要的一个功能,它保证了系统内部各个设备的时间一致性。Linux和Windows均提供了对时钟同步的支持,但它们的实现方式略有不同。
2.1 Linux的时钟同步
Linux使用NTP(Network Time Protocol)实现时钟同步。NTP是一种用于同步计算机系统时间的协议,它通过与时间服务器进行通信来获取准确的时间。对于Linux用户来说,通过配置NTP客户端,可以自动将系统时间与时间服务器进行同步。
# 在Linux上配置NTP客户端
# 安装NTP服务
sudo apt-get install ntp
# 配置NTP服务器地址
sudo vi /etc/ntp.conf
# 重启NTP服务
sudo service ntp restart
通过以上步骤,Linux系统将会自动从指定的时间服务器同步时间,并保持时间的准确性。
2.2 Windows的时钟同步
Windows使用Windows Time(W32Time)服务实现时钟同步。W32Time是微软开发的一种时间同步服务,它能够从互联网上的时间服务器获取准确的时间。
// 在Windows上配置时间同步
// 使用命令行工具配置时间服务器
w32tm /config /syncfromflags:manual /manualpeerlist:"pool.ntp.org"
w32tm /config /reliable:yes
w32tm /config /update
// 启动时间同步服务
w32tm /start
通过以上步骤,Windows系统将会自动从指定的时间服务器同步时间,并确保时间的准确性。
3. 日期和时间设置
除了时钟同步,设置日期和时间也是操作系统中的重要功能。用户需要能够轻松地更改系统的日期和时间,以便适应各种不同的需求。
3.1 Linux的日期和时间设置
在Linux中,用户可以使用date命令来设置日期和时间。date命令提供了许多选项,可以用来指定具体的日期和时间。
# 在Linux上设置日期和时间
# 设置日期
sudo date -s "2022-01-01"
# 设置时间
sudo date -s "12:00:00"
通过以上命令,用户可以轻松地设置Linux系统的日期和时间。
3.2 Windows的日期和时间设置
在Windows中,用户可以通过系统设置界面来更改日期和时间。用户可以通过以下步骤来进行设置:
右键点击任务栏上的时间,并选择"调整日期/时间"。
在弹出的窗口中,点击"更改日期和时间"。
在日期和时间设置界面,用户可以手动更改日期和时间。
点击"确定"来保存更改。
通过以上步骤,用户可以轻松地在Windows系统中设置日期和时间。
4. 时间跟踪
时间跟踪是指计算机系统对时间的记录和追踪。对于一些涉及到时间敏感的应用程序来说,时间跟踪非常重要。
4.1 Linux的时间跟踪
在Linux中,系统会自动记录时间的变化,并提供一些工具来查看和分析时间的变化。
# 在Linux上查看系统时间
date
# 在Linux上查看时间变化记录
dmesg | grep "clock"
通过以上命令,用户可以查看系统的当前时间,并且可以通过系统日志来跟踪时间的变化。
4.2 Windows的时间跟踪
在Windows中,系统也会自动记录时间的变化,并提供一些工具来查看和分析时间的变化。
// 在Windows上查看系统时间
time /t
// 在Windows上查看时间变化记录
wevtutil qe System /f:text /c:"[Event/EventID=1]"
通过以上命令,用户可以查看系统的当前时间,并且可以通过系统日志来跟踪时间的变化。
5. 总结
Linux和Windows操作系统在时间管理功能上有着一些不同之处。Linux使用NTP来实现时钟同步,而Windows使用W32Time来实现时钟同步。在日期和时间设置方面,Linux用户可以使用date命令来设置日期和时间,而Windows用户可以通过系统设置界面来进行设置。在时间跟踪方面,Linux和Windows均提供了工具来查看和分析时间的变化。
无论是Linux还是Windows,时间管理对于计算机用户来说非常重要。通过合理地使用操作系统提供的时间管理功能,用户可以确保系统时间的准确性,并且能够满足各种不同的时间需求。